LUX dives into wellness

LUX Resorts has announced a collaboration with Olympian swimmer Emma Igelström to bring wellness experiences to the LUX South Ari Atoll in Maldives.

The Maldivian resort will host the Olympian for an exclusive wellness weekend from September 20 to September 22 and guests will be able to participate in activities curated by Igelström. The activities are complimentary for all guests staying at the resort at the time.

The activities will cater for all fitness levels and range from beginner-friendly swim classes, mobility sessions, informative wellness talks and relaxation practices. The resort will also host a beach aquathlon for families.

Igelström has won five World Championships and 12 European Championships and has set seven world records for breaststroke. She is an advocate for health and wellness and has founded swimming academies across the world and published books on her story.

The programme for the weekend is as follows:

  • September 20: Swim class for all levels (morning); meditation and breath work class (afternoon)
  • September 21: Mobility class (morning); family beach aquathlon (afternoon)
  • September 22: Swim for Wellness talk (morning); relaxation class (afternoon)
